Over the past two months, we've seen dozens of crypto companies go bankrupt/shut down.
To name a few: Dango, BitMEX, Zapper (Mark Cuban-backed btw), Rodeo, Entropy (and more).
This is exactly what we see every cycle, and tbh, it's probably exactly what we need to properly bottom before sending higher.
(In 2022, it was FTX, Celsius, Voyager, Three Arrows Capital).
Just like the stock market flushes out overhyped and overvalued stocks, so does the crypto market.
I actually don't think this is bearish; in fact, it's probably a good sign of our industry maturing, and this is just generally a normal symptom of the bottoming process.
(btw, this isn't a dig at BitMEX at all. I genuinely wish their shutdown to be as smooth as possible - just highlighting this isn't anything to be worried about and crypto isn't "dying"; this is just a normal part of the market bottoming process)
